The MSED made six presentations during the review, which focused on the Polymer Processing Group, the Thermodynamics and Kinetics Group, the Mechanical Performance Group, the Polymer and Complex Fluids Group, the Functional Polymers Group, and the Functional Nanostructured Materials Group.

Four projects within the MSED -- the additive manufacturing of metals, mechanical standards, performance under extreme conditions, and automotive lightweighting -- are highly pertinent to achieving national goals throughout the materials innovation continuum.

State-of-the-art instrumentation developments within the polymer-side of MSED include the resonant soft X-ray small angle scattering instrument; the modified MakerBot 3D printer; a novel three-in-one instrument that allows for correlations of polymer rheology with underlying microstructure and composition; an automated multifiber fragmentation machine; a microcapillary rheometer; and a layer-bylayer method for the highly controlled fabrication of model membranes for water purification.

... The Functional Nanostructured Materials Group has 81 reviewed research publications -- which is an outstanding record of public dissemination of scientific results. In the polymers research focus, 27 permanent MSED staff produced approximately 240 publications in peer-reviewed journals and conducted 300 invited talks.
